Drywall corner bead of metal is a type of trim that is used to protect the corners of drywall panels from damage. It is made from a variety of metals, including steel, aluminum, and copper, and is available in a range of sizes and shapes to suit different applications. The bead is installed at the corners of the drywall panels, where it provides a smooth, durable surface that can withstand impacts and abrasions. One of the primary benefits of using drywall corner bead of metal is that it provides a strong and stable surface for finishing. The metal bead is attached to the drywall using screws or adhesive, and it creates a straight, even edge that is easy to finish with joint compound. This results in a professional-looking finish that is free from cracks, chips, and other imperfections. Another advantage of using drywall corner bead of metal is that it is resistant to damage from moisture and humidity. Unlike traditional paper or plastic corner beads, metal corner beads are not susceptible to warping, cracking, or rotting, making them ideal for use in high-moisture environments such as bathrooms and kitchens. In addition to its functional benefits, drywall corner bead of metal can also be used to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a room. Metal corner beads are available in a range of finishes, including brushed, polished, and textured, which can be used to create a variety of decorative effects. Overall, drywall corner bead of metal is a versatile and durable trim that is ideal for protecting the corners of drywall panels and creating a professional-looking finish. Its resistance to moisture and customizable finishes make it a popular choice for both residential and commercial applications.
